By all accounts, Gomes was a very capable "glue guy" who also showed the ability to defend ... While putting up points and rebounds consistently. On the season, he played an average of 29.7 minutes per game and appeared in all 82 games (starting 74), scoring nearly 13 points and grabbing almost six rebounds a game.
His best game of the season came on Jan. 21 at Golden State, when he scored a career-high 35 points with 11 rebounds in a Minnesota road win to become one of seven players in franchise history to go over 35 and 10.

In a more global sense, his importance is signified by the fact that Minnesota won 11-of-18 games in which Gomes scored 15+ points, and he, in the hearts of many the Wolves' fans, should be Minnesota's number one priority this offseason.
